Ant-Man star Michael Douglas found out about his part in the upcoming Disney+ series What If...? during a recent interview.

While sitting down with Collider, Douglas was asked about his upcoming projects, namely, The Kominsky Method. Towards the end of their conversation, the interviewer asked Douglas, "What does it mean to be part of the biggest box office movie all time? and my other thing is, I'm so excited you're doing this thing, What If...? Where you're voicing Hank Pym in an animated thing."

Douglas responded with wide eyed surprise, asking, "Am I?" The two shared a laugh before Douglas clarified, saying, "They haven't told me yet... I'm gonna find out after this. I have no idea."

The two went on to briefly discuss Douglas' role in Avengers: EndgameDuring the sequence where Steve Rogers and Tony Stark return to the past, Douglas has a brief cameo as young Hank Pym.

According to Douglas, Ant-Man 3 will begin production in January 2021What If...? on the other hand, does not currently have a release date. The animated series slated to arrive on Disney+ sometime during Summer 2021.
